AI agents are exploding across the enterprise—but security hasn’t caught up. In this episode of Today in Tech, host Keith Shaw talks with Michael Bargury, co-founder and CTO of Zenity, about why every AI agent is inherently vulnerable, how zero-click attacks work, and what companies must do now to reduce their risk.
Bargury explains how attackers can hijack AI agents with simple persuasion, plant malicious “memories,” and silently exfiltrate sensitive data from tools like Microsoft Copilot, ChatGPT, Salesforce, and Cursor, often without users ever clicking on anything.
